Dentures endure a surprising amount of stress every day. Over months and years, that wear and tear can lead to fractures in the acrylic base, teeth that pop loose, or clasps that no longer grip properly. Our denture repair in Crozet VA covers a wide range of issues, including:
We handle most standard repairs efficiently so you spend as little time as possible without your dentures. One critical piece of advice: never attempt a do-it-yourself fix with household adhesive. Commercial glues contain chemicals that can damage acrylic, throw off your bite alignment, and even irritate your gum tissue.
A denture rebase involves replacing the entire pink acrylic base of your denture while keeping the existing teeth in place. Think of it as giving your denture a brand-new foundation. Rebasing is recommended when the teeth themselves are still in good condition but the base material has become worn, stained, or weakened from years of use.
The process is straightforward. We take a fresh impression of your gums, send the denture to our lab, and the old base is swapped out for a new one molded to match your current mouth shape. You get a denture that fits like new at a fraction of the cost of a full replacement.
A reline adds a new inner layer to the existing base to improve fit. A rebase replaces the base entirely. If the base is in reasonable shape and just needs a better contour, a reline is usually sufficient. If the base material is old, brittle, or has been repaired multiple times, a rebase delivers a more reliable long-term result. Our dentists will examine your denture closely and recommend whichever option gives you the best value.
